The Wisconsin Interscholastic Athletic Association (WIAA) Boys Basketball Tournament 2026 officially began today, drawing unprecedented crowds and excitement across the state. Held at the Kohl Center in Madison, Wisconsin, the tournament marks the culmination of the high school basketball season, featuring the state's top teams competing for the championship title.

This year's tournament is trending nationwide due to its record-breaking attendance and the inclusion of several standout players who have already garnered attention from college scouts. Fans from across Wisconsin have flocked to Madison, creating a vibrant atmosphere and showcasing the deep-rooted passion for high school sports in the region.
